EMERGENCY and Essential Surgical care (EESC) programme 1 | EMERGENCY & TRAUMA care TRAINING COURSE Basic TRAUMA , Anesthesia and Surgical Skills for Frontline Health Providers Including management of injuries in women, children, elderly and humanitarian emergencies EMERGENCY & Essential Surgical care Clinical Procedures Unit Department of Health Systems Policies & Workforce World Health Organization Geneva, Switzerland EMERGENCY and Essential Surgical care (EESC) programme 2 | INTRODUCTION Objectives: This COURSE is about managing TRAUMA , from minor injury to humanitarian emergencies, including injuries in women, children and the elderly, with the principal goal of improving quality of care and patient safety.
